About Pyrénées-Orientales department
Stretching from Mediterranean shoreline to the foothills of the Pyrenees, Pyrénées-Orientales combines coastal resorts, inland towns and mountain landscapes in one department. That geography gives the area a distinctive appeal, with apartment markets shaped by both seaside and cross-border influences. July 2026 points first to a tighter investment equation than a pure price upswing. Apartments in Pyrénées-Orientales now average €148,000, while the average rent sits at €580, producing a yield of 5.42%. The monthly movement is still upward on the sales side, but only modestly: the average sale price is up 0.7% and the average rent is up 0.2%. The broader picture is more mixed. At €2,690 per square metre, the average apartment price is up 2.5% over the month, yet it remains down 1.0% year on year. That combination suggests recent stabilization after earlier softening, even as the annual sale price level is still 4.5% below last year. For investors, the message in July 2026 is clear: prices are moving again, but income growth is only edging forward, so returns depend more on careful entry pricing than on rapid rental acceleration.

Summary and Key Takeaways
With a median rental yield of 5.42% and property prices starting at €77,000, Pyrénées-Orientales department
may become a good investment option for some investors.
Median property prices in Pyrénées-Orientales department are €148,000, while the median rent is €580. This means that a median property in Pyrénées-Orientales department will pay for itself in 21.3 years.
Detailed real estate yield breakdown:
A median 1-bedroom apartment: 7.01% yield, sale price €77,000, rent €450.
A median 2-bedroom apartment: 5.25% yield, sale price €127,000, rent €560.
A median 3-bedroom apartment: 4.84% yield, sale price €176,000, rent €710.
A median 4+ bedroom apartment: 5.22% yield, sale price €204,500, rent €890.
